Produce Basics: Starting Off

So, you're keen in drying produce? Excellent choice! Starting with a dehydrator can seem a bit complicated at first, but it’s actually quite simple. Most contemporary electric appliances are surprisingly simple to operate. You'll typically need just a few fundamental supplies: fresh fruit, a sharp knife, and of course, your dehydrator itself. Start by choosing a project – there are lots available online or in manuals. Then, carefully rinse your produce, dice them into even pieces—about ¼ inch dense is ideal—and place them in a single layer on the shelves of your drying unit. Remember that preserving times will vary based on the type of food and your appliance's settings. Enjoy fun playing around!

Maximizing Your Produce's Potential

Achieving truly amazing results with your food dryer is more than just tossing fruit in and setting the timer; it's about mastering the nuances of the method. New dehydrators often make common oversights like overcrowding the shelves, which inhibits ventilation and leads to uneven drying. Consider blanching your items – a quick blanch for some vegetables prevents discoloration and helps with consistency. Remember that various items require different temperatures and times; experimentation is key to discovering what works best for your particular dehydrator and desired results. Ultimately, a little precise preparation goes a long way toward creating delicious, shelf-stable treats.
